Skip to content

Commit 2f142e8

Browse files
committed
Use Microsoft.SqlServer.Compact nuget package
1 parent 366b4dc commit 2f142e8

File tree

2 files changed

+9
-2
lines changed

2 files changed

+9
-2
lines changed

src/NHibernate.TestDatabaseSetup/NHibernate.TestDatabaseSetup.csproj

Lines changed: 8 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-81,8 +81,7 @@
8181
</Reference>
8282
<Reference Include="System.Data" />
8383
<Reference Include="System.Data.SqlServerCe, Version=4.0.0.0, Culture=neutral, PublicKeyToken=89845dcd8080cc91, processorArchitecture=MSIL">
84-
<SpecificVersion>False</SpecificVersion>
85-
<HintPath>..\..\lib\teamcity\sqlServerCe\System.Data.SqlServerCe.dll</HintPath>
84+
<HintPath>..\packages\Microsoft.SqlServer.Compact.4.0.8876.1\lib\net40\System.Data.SqlServerCe.dll</HintPath>
8685
<Private>True</Private>
8786
</Reference>
8887
</ItemGroup>
@@ -108,6 +107,13 @@
108107
</ProjectReference>
109108
</ItemGroup>
110109
<Import Project="$(MSBuildToolsPath)\Microsoft.CSharp.targets" />
110+
<PropertyGroup>
111+
<PostBuildEvent>
112+
if not exist "$(TargetDir)x86" md "$(TargetDir)x86"
113+
xcopy /s /y "$(SolutionDir)packages\Microsoft.SqlServer.Compact.4.0.8876.1\NativeBinaries\x86\*.*" "$(TargetDir)x86"
114+
if not exist "$(TargetDir)amd64" md "$(TargetDir)amd64"
115+
xcopy /s /y "$(SolutionDir)packages\Microsoft.SqlServer.Compact.4.0.8876.1\NativeBinaries\amd64\*.*" "$(TargetDir)amd64"</PostBuildEvent>
116+
</PropertyGroup>
111117
<!-- To modify your build process, add your task inside one of the targets below and uncomment it.
112118
Other similar extension points exist, see Microsoft.Common.targets.
113119
<Target Name="BeforeBuild">
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
<?xml version="1.0" encoding="utf-8"?>
22
<packages>
33
<package id="FirebirdSql.Data.FirebirdClient" version="5.0.5" targetFramework="net40" />
4+
<package id="Microsoft.SqlServer.Compact" version="4.0.8876.1" targetFramework="net40" />
45
<package id="Npgsql" version="2.2.7" targetFramework="net40" />
56
<package id="NUnit" version="2.6.4" targetFramework="net40" />
67
</packages>

0 commit comments

Comments
 (0)